Gasteria bicolour

Lawyers Tongue

Commonly known as Lawyers Tongue, this is a popular and colourful succulent. The fleshly and mottled leaves emerge with red tones and age to become dark green. Flower stems bearing pink-orange flowers are often produced in late winter. It grows as a somewhat sporadic clump to about 20 cm tall and the same wide, but often reaches only half this size when grown in a container. This variety prefers to grow in full sun on a well-drained site, and will tolerate light frost and extended dry periods. Lawyers Tongue is commonly grown in rock and Mediterranean gardens, maintained in a container, or used in border plantings.
